Frequently Asked Questions
Can JRR clear brush along a fence line?
Yes. Fence-line and access clearing can be estimated after JRR reviews boundaries, vegetation, equipment access and any protected or excluded areas.
Do you remove invasive vegetation?
Invasive vegetation removal can be included as a site-specific scope. JRR does not claim pesticide application or guarantee permanent eradication.
Can brush be hauled away?
Yes. Material may be processed on site or hauled depending on vegetation, volume, access, owner preference and the approved estimate.
How does a Land Clearing Rangers estimate work?
JRR reviews the property, intended scope, vegetation, trees and stumps, access, ground conditions, equipment needs, hauling, urgency and owner-confirmed approvals before providing an estimate. Every job is unique.
Are permits included?
No. The property owner is responsible for determining and obtaining required permits, surveys and official approvals. JRR can provide information about its proposed work and equipment.
Do you handle hazardous or regulated material found on a site?
No. JRR does not accept, load, transport or dispose of hazardous or regulated waste. Work pauses when unidentified or prohibited material affects the approved scope.
